Steam link: https://store.steampowered.com/app/1846820/
Short Description:
Platforms:
Publishers:
Developers:
Release: Apr 7, 2022 (2 years, 7 months ago)
Price: N/A
Reviews: 147
Score: 5/10
Followers: N/A
Tags: Level Editor
Genres:
Revenue Estimate: ~$ N/A